American Airlines is introducing new spring menu options for customers both inflight and in its Admirals Club lounges, along with the option to use AAdvantage miles to purchase food and beverages.
Air Canada has announced the addition of Michelin-starred Chef Masaki Hashimoto to its culinary panel. His exclusive creations have debuted in Air Canada Signature Class, on all flights between Canada and Japan.
SWISS has introduced a new onboard experience for customers travelling in Economy and Premium Economy on long-haul flights. The revamped CX includes product innovations and new service features.
Delta Air Lines, which is celebrating its centennial year, has partnered with Maison Taittinger. The partnership with the luxury Champagne brand is part of efforts to provide “a best-in-class onboard experience”.

Brussels Airlines is introducing a new gastronomic experience for long-haul Business Class passengers from January 2025. The menu has been carefully concocted by Michelin-starred chef Arabelle Meirlaen.
Emirates is spreading Christmas cheer for travellers throughout December, with traditional treats and festive fare available across its international lounges and onboard, with festive inflight entertainment.
Air France has introduced new comfort kits onboard its long-haul flights in the La Première, Business, and Premium cabins. The comfort kits are “carefully designed to meet the needs of each passenger”.
Turkish Airlines – a Corporate Partner of the FTE Digital, Innovation & Startup Hub – and Kaelis have introduced “a fun and engaging kids’ kit designed to make young travellers’ journeys even more enjoyable”.
British Airways – a member of International Airlines Group (a Corporate Partner of the FTE Digital, Innovation & Startup Hub) – is planning a “British Original Christmas”, including a bespoke seasonal menu.
Turkish Airlines – a Corporate Partner of the FTE Digital, Innovation & Startup Hub – has introduced a new amenity kit collection for Business Class travellers, which is designed in collaboration with Lanvin.
Delta has launched a partnership with Shake Shack on flights from Boston, with plans for expansion to other U.S. markets throughout 2025, as it “elevates the inflight dining and hospitality experience”.
Etihad Airways has launched limited-edition amenity kits, which are complimentary for guests on selected flights. The seasonal gift is part of efforts to provide guests with a “special touch and warm welcome”.
Delta is refreshing its one-of-a-kind seasonal wine program and adding new snacks and meals designed in partnership with award-winning chefs, as it aims to “turn routine travel into an unforgettable journey”.
airBaltic has introduced a new Business Class menu, available throughout the winter season until the end of March 2025, as part of efforts to “continuously enhance customers’ inflight experience”.
airBaltic has launched a new meal pre-order concept created to improve the inflight dining experience in Economy Class. The new concept features a more diverse range and increased personalisation.
